90 Bakewell Street

    90, BAKEWELL STREET, COALVILLE, LE67 3BA

    This semi-detached freehold property on Bakewell Street last sold in April 2018 for £138,500. Based on price growth in the LE67 district since then, its estimated current value is £181,652 — placing it in the 20th percentile nationally and the 18th percentile within LE67. The property covers 99 m² (1,066 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,835 per m². The EPC rating is F, with a potential rating of B.
